Ann Swanson

Ann Swanson, MS, C-IAYT, LMT, E-RYT 500, is a yoga therapist, author of Science of Yoga, and master teacher trainer for the evidence-based program Yoga for Arthritis. She is part heart-based yogi and part science nerd. Ann supports people in living happier, healthier lives by making wellness non-intimidating and accessible to everyone, especially those who feel like they “can’t” do yoga and those dealing with chronic pain. With a master of science in yoga therapy and roots studying yoga in India, Ann uniquely applies cutting-edge research to mind-body practices while maintaining the heart of the traditions.
